A leading employment support organization in the UK is seeking an Employment Specialist to deliver person-centred employment support to individuals facing health and social barriers. The position is full-time and hybrid, requiring regular travel across the Leeds area.

Responsibilities include managing a caseload and engaging with community partners to create pathways into competitive employment.

The role requires strong experience in similar fields and relevant qualifications, with a starting salary of £28,925 per annum.

How to prepare for a job interview at edt

Know Your Stuff

Make sure you understand the role of an Employment Specialist inside out. Familiarise yourself with person-centred employment support and the specific health and social barriers individuals face. This will help you demonstrate your expertise and show that you're genuinely interested in making a difference.

Showcase Your Experience

Prepare to discuss your previous experience in similar roles. Think of specific examples where you've successfully managed a caseload or engaged with community partners. Use the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result) to structure your answers and highlight your achievements.

Be Ready to Travel

Since this role requires regular travel across the Leeds area, be prepared to discuss your flexibility and willingness to travel. Mention any previous experiences where you've had to adapt to different locations or work environments, as this shows your readiness for the hybrid nature of the job.

Ask Thoughtful Questions

At the end of the interview, have a few insightful questions ready to ask. Inquire about the organisation's approach to supporting individuals with health and social barriers or how they measure success in their employment programmes. This not only shows your interest but also helps you gauge if the company aligns with your values.
